T-Mobile and KKR to Acquire Metronet, Expanding Fiber Network Reach
Market T-Mobile and KKR to Acquire Metronet, Expanding Fiber Network Reach

The strategic acquisition of Metronet by T-Mobile, in partnership with KKR, marks a pivotal move in the telecom landscape. This transaction aims to extend T-Mobile's fiber network capabilities and broadband services across the United States, impacting both residential and commercial connectivity.
